The Sulligent Blue Devils will face off against the South Lamar Stallions at 1:15 p.m. on Wednesday. The squads are rolling into the game with opposing streaks: Sulligent has struggled recently with four losses in a row, while South Lamar will arrive with five straight wins.
Sulligent fell victim to Lamar County and their airtight pitching crew on Tuesday. They lost 10-0 to the Bulldogs.
Meanwhile, South Lamar got the win against Pickens Academy on Tuesday by a conclusive 10-3. The Stallions might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won nine contests by seven runs or more this season.
South Lamar's victory bumped their record up to 11-6. As for Sulligent, their defeat dropped their record down to 7-11.
